+package com.oracle.graal.compiler.hsail.test;
+
+import org.junit.Test;
+
+/**
+ * This test tests an int stream where we deliberately cause a NPE to test throwing the exception
+ * back to the java code. In addition, it is set up so the bci of the exception point is not zero.
+ */
+public class IntStreamNullCatchNonZeroBciTest extends SingleExceptionTestBase {
+
+    static final int num = 20;
+
+    static class BasePoint {
+        int x;
+        int y;
+
+        public BasePoint(int x, int y) {
+            this.x = x;
+            this.y = y;
+        }
+
+        public int getX() {
+            return x;
+        }
+
+        public int getY() {
+            return y;
+        }
+    }
+
+    static class MyPoint extends BasePoint {
+        public MyPoint(int x, int y) {
+            super(x, y);
+        }
+    }
+
+    BasePoint[] inputs = new BasePoint[num];
+    MyPoint[] outputs = new MyPoint[num];
+
+    void setupArrays() {
+        for (int i = 0; i < num; i++) {
+            inputs[i] = new MyPoint(i, i + 1);
+        }
+        inputs[10] = null;
+    }
+
+    @Result public int nullSeenGid;
+    @Result public int nullSeenAdjustment;
+
+    public void run(int gid) {
+        // gid 10 should always throw NPE
+        MyPoint mp = (MyPoint) inputs[gid];
+        int adjustment = 0;
+        int tmp = gid;
+        while (tmp-- >= 0) {
+            adjustment += tmp;
+        }
+        try {
+            mp.x = mp.y + adjustment;
+        } catch (NullPointerException e) {
+            nullSeenGid = gid;
+            nullSeenAdjustment = adjustment;
+        }
+        outputs[gid] = mp;
+    }
+
+    @Override
+    public void runTest() {
+        setupArrays();
+        try {
+            dispatchMethodKernel(num);
+        } catch (Exception e) {
+            recordException(e);
+        }
+    }
+
+    @Test
+    public void test() {
+        super.testGeneratedHsail();
+    }
+}
